—25— With an aim to establish the correct taxonomic status of some commonly used Thai materia medica, e.g., Wan Ron Thong, Wan Phaya Hong Thong, Wan Phaya Hong Ngen, Wan Krachai Thong, for future research in drug development, we have extended our study into the tribe Globbeae Petersen (Zingiberaceae) in Thailand. This tribe consists of three genera: Hemiorchis Kurz, Gagnepainia K. Schum. and Globba L. The genus Hemiorchis Kurz in Thailand was revised (Picheansoonthon et al. 2009) and the revision of the genus Gagnepainia K. Schum. is scheduled to be published. The genus Globba L. is one of the largest genera of the family Zingiberaceae. Forty-one species were preliminarily listed for Thailand (Larsen and Larsen 2006). It was recently classifed into three subgenera: Mantisia (Sims) K. J. Williams, Ceratanthera (Horan.) K. J. Williams and Globba based on phylogenetic studies (Williams et al. 2004). A species producing the flowering shoots before the leafy shoots, Globba praecox Chokthaweep. & al., was recently added (Chokthaweepanich et al. 2005). This taxon was placed in the subgenus Mantisia (Sims) K. J. Williams, sect. Haplanthera (Horan.) Petersen (characterized by the anthers without any appendages). In this paper, the second species, Globba ranongensis Picheans. & Tiyawora., with the same features (flowering shoots appear before the leafy shoots), but of subgenus Globba, section Nudae K. Larsen, subsect. Mediocalcaratae (K. Schum.) K. J. Williams (characterized by the two anther appendages), is recognized with full description and illustration.
